44份流苏树种质资源种实性状综合评价

Comprehensive Evaluation of Seed and Fruit Traits in 44 Chionanthus retusus Germplasm Resources

摘要 为筛选具有优良种实性状的流苏树种质,构建流苏树种质资源种实性状评价体系,本研究对44份流苏树种质资源的12个种实表型性状、树高和胸径指标进行研究,对各种实表型性状的分布规律进行分析。结果表明,14个性状的变异系数为9.00%~45.00%,均值20.13%,遗传多样性指标(H′)为1.69~2.07,均值为1.96,存在丰富的变异;相关性分析结果表明,14个性状中,实壳比与出仁率呈极显著正相关,这表明实壳比越大,出仁率越高。种壳厚度和出仁率呈极显著负相关,种壳厚度越厚出仁率越低。聚类分析结果显示,44份流苏树种质资源可分为4个组,流苏树的种实表型遗传变异表现出不连续性和不稳定性,具有随机变异的特点;主成分分析结果表明,T-8的综合评价最好,其次为G-8,WS-2的综合评价较低。逐步回归分析筛选出3个性状,可作为流苏树种实评价指标,即果实纵径、种子横径、出仁率。 In order to screen the germplasm of Chionanthus retusus with excellent seed and fruit characters,the evaluation system for seed and fruit characters of Chionanthus retusus germplasm resources was constructed.The phenotypic traits,tree height and DBH of 12 species in 44 germplasm resources of Chionanthus retusus were studied,and the distribution of various phenotypic traits was analysed.The results showed that the coefficient of variation of 14 traits ranged from 9.00%to 45.00%,with an average of 20.13%,and the genetic diversity index(H′)ranged from 1.69 to 2.07,with an average of 1.96,showing abundant variation.Correlation analysis showed that the ratio of solid shell was positively significantly correlated with yield of 14 traits,indicating that the larger the ratio of solid shell was,the higher the yield was.There was a significant negative correlation between seed shell thickness and yield.The thicker the seed shell thickness,the lower the yield.The results of cluster analysis showed that the 44 germplasm resources of Chionanthus retusus could be divided into four groups.The genetic variation of the species phenotype of Chionanthus retusus showed discontinuity and instability,and had the characteristics of random variation.The results of principal component analysis showed that T-8 had the best comprehensive evaluation,followed by G-8,and WS-2 had the lower comprehensive evaluation.Three traits were selected by stepwise regression analysis,which could be used as evaluation indexes for germplasm resources of Chionanthus retusus,namely,longitudinal diameter of fruit,transverse diameter of seed and yield.
